Garden City, N.Y. — Construction is complete for the new performing arts and recreation complex at Adelphi University in Garden City.

The project included the renovation of Olmstead Theatre and Woodruff Hall as well as the addition of the Center for Recreation and Sports. Woodruff Hall now includes recreation facilities, offices, labs, classrooms and a pool. A new glass lobby was added to the building’s south side and serves as the primary entrance to the Center for Recreation and Sports,  which features features a three-court, below-grade gymnasium. A 310-space, underground parking garage was constructed with varsity athletic fields on top of it. The western part of the complex consists of the renovated 350-seat Olmstead Theatre and the addition of 60,000 square feet of performing arts space that includes practice rooms, teaching studios, classrooms, a concert hall, and additional performance venues. The project is also applying for LEED-Silver certification. Cannon Design was the project architect.
